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1709678780 1523628130 41005738755 534 634145264
693469558 21784 487606
693469558 21784 487606
0405 167251719 09590
All about undefined
Interested in learning more?
693469558 21784 487606
0405 167251719 09590
See more
4542 36 7179882
36 84604 8490257629 131 10931599
See more
316 16943
04 1184768 785 046 75
See more